LEADERSHIP REVIEW — Northern Region Sales

Quick brief ahead of the board session: Northern region came in 7% under target, dragged down by slow uptake of the Seltra range in Brackford. Renewals held up well, though, and Aldview's team beat quota again. We'll walk through corrective actions on the call. The bigger strategic question is flagged in the note below.

confidential, kagep-kahof: Druokax Systems plans to lower the Ulaath list price by 53 percent in March.

# Approvals: Offline Mode — Surveya Field App

Offline mode ships behind the `offline_cache` flag. Sync conflicts resolve last-write-wins; escalate anything else. Do not enable for tenants on legacy storage. Approval required before any flag flip in production. Check the sync queue depth first; over 5k pending items means wait. All enablement requests must be approved by the person named below.

approver of yajef-fajef = Oliwyn Silion Kasok Kasox

### Step 2: Enable the Batch Loader

The Fennelmark GraphQL gateway previously issued one query per author node, causing N+1 load on reviews. This step activates the dataloader middleware, which batches lookups per request. Verify batching locally before deploying. Run the gateway against the staging reviews database using the connection string that follows.

warehouse DSN: clickhouse://druys_svc:Pl@db-47e1.orvexstack.corp:5432/beldor